Cypraeovula edentulata, common name : the toothless cowrie, is a species of sea snail, a cowry, a marine gastropod mollusk in the family Cypraeidae, the cowries.[1]
Distribution
This marine species is distributed along Tanzania and the East Coast of South Africa.
